摘要
目的:提高宣清和化方质量标准。方法:在现行质量标准的基础上,建立宣清和化方中大青叶、黄芩、甘草的薄层鉴别方法;同时采用HPLC法对宣清和化方中黄芩苷、菊苣酸进行含量测定,色谱柱:inertsil?ODS-3柱(250 mm×4.6 mm, 5μm);流动相:乙腈-0.2%磷酸水溶液,梯度洗脱;流速:1.0 ml·min^(-1);检测波长:280 nm、327 nm;柱温:30℃;进样量:10μl。结果:TLC斑点清晰,分离度好,阴性对照无干扰。黄芩苷、菊苣酸分别在进样浓度121.24~848.68μg·ml^(-1)(r=0.999 9)、5.26~63.12μg·ml^(-1)(r=0.999 9)范围内与峰面积呈良好线性关系;精密度、稳定性、重复性试验的RSD均小于3.0%(n=6);平均加样回收率分别为99.53%、98.98%,RSD分别为2.20%、1.85%(n=6)。结论:该方法快速、准确、专属性强,可用于宣清和化方的质量控制。
Objective: To improve the quality standard for Xuanqing Hehua prescription.Methods: Based on the previous quality standard, TLC identification methods were established for Isatidis Folium, Scutellariae Radix and Licorice;the contents of baicalin and cichoric acid in Xuanqing Hehua prescription were determined by HPLC method on an inertsil?ODS-3(250 mm×4.6 mm, 5 μm) analytical column, and the mobile phase was composed of acetonitrile-0.2% phosphoric acid solution with gradient elution, the flow rate was 1.0 ml·min^(-1), the detection wavelengths were 280 and 327 nm, the column temperature was 30℃, and the volume injection was 10 μl.Results: TLC spots were clear and well-separated without any negative interference;the calibration curves of baicalin and cichoric acid were linear over the range of(121.24-848.68) μg·ml^(-1)(r=0.999 9) and(5.26-63.12) μg·ml^(-1)(r=0.999 9), respectively, and the RSDs of precision, stability and repeatability tests were all no more than 3.0%(n=6);the average recoveries were 99.53% and 98.98% with the RSDs of 2.20% and 1.85%, respectively(n=6). Conclusion: The method is fast and accurate with good specificity, and can be used for the quality control of Xuanqing Hehua prescription.
